Athletics is a thriving summer sport at Welbeck. Expert coaching is provided in most disciplines, with group sessions provided in throwing and jumping field events as well as there being a sprint group and an endurance group.
Coaching is generally on Wednesday and Saturday afternoons, although other sessions are sometimes fitted in elsewhere in the week depending on the needs of the athletes. The coaching sessions are held both in the college grounds and at the highly regarded Paula Radcliffe international track at Loughborough University. A programme of strength and conditioning using med balls, power bags and Pilates supplements the coaching for the individual disciplines.
Students have the opportunity to compete in several track meets throughout the summer term. There are competitions against other local independent schools, the college inter house sports day, the Leicestershire Schools Championship. In addition to this a handful of students are good enough and enthusiastic enough to compete in local open meets hosted by Charnwood AC again at the Loughborough University track.
Whilst participation in athletics is important to encourage, there are always athletes who are more serious about their sport – in recent years there have been several students who have represented their county at the English Schools meet in July, and some who have represented their country at their discipline. Several students have in the past taken the opportunity to join Charnwood AC and have represented the club in various meets around the country. It is possible to provide all year round coaching for the most serious athletes.
